Hi all, please help. I downloaded and instaled XP Home SP3 onto my 
girlfriend's laptop yesterday after being asked to by Windows Update. 
Everything went well and she's using it fine. However, we've ran into a 
snag. We've been trying to run manual virus scans with Avast, and everything

goes well till a few minutes afterwards, when the computer suddenly shuts 
off and the laptop won't come on at all until after a few minutes. By "won't

come on" I mean the power button does nothing. She's had similar problems in

the past, but we thought a new charger would help, but it's even happening 
when running on battery. Is this a known issue with XP SP3, or is it 
something sinister, like an overheating processor? It seems that the laptop 
runs fine until she does disk intensive activities, from my observations 
anyway. Thanks in advance for the help.
